I thought I would share this parking that I have found, online the quote is £2 a day but if you call they will offer a reduced rate :-)

I haven't used it before however all the Gatwick car parks wanted an excess of £120 for my car for 16 nights in August.
I found an online booking page and it came to £34 however I called as I wanted to ensure its ok for holiday parking rather than a daily rate, she confirmed it was fine that it is locked at night so may not be any good for night flights.
I said I had the online booking and she said its not direct with us however if you are booking direct I can give you a better rate so £25 for 16 nights!

Fingers crossed its a all good for my car I cant find reviews either way, it looks to be just a regular car park about 5 mins from the airport.

    It's actually the old council car park in Crawley town centre located between the old Babcock building (hence the name I guess) and Crawley Town Hall.

    Not really airport parking as it will still be a 15 minute drive to Gatwick, about a £12-£15 cab ride each way.

    Crawley railway station is about a 10 minute walk. Two stops down the line to Gatwick at a cost of £2.20 each way. Not however an option if you have luggage.

    It's cheap but I think your car will still be at the mercy of undesirables, especially if they work out that you have let the car there for some days.

    I would suggest using one of the approved airport car parking operators.
